Transaction eb5eb6bfffe82e60a56100a03395087d7c35e954186b80bc07367d83e7b6cc4a
1 Input
1 Output
-
eb5eb6bfffe82e60a56100a03395087d7c35e954186b80bc07367d83e7b6cc4a:0
- value
- 1390497
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d8b623b35eeb9b27702b89537e18170b87694c94 OP_EQUAL
- address
- 3MSt5FUVwE3PhsPfrXAGhL9kLo8GeE4FrR